PIASA - Josie Hagen closed her senior softball season at Southwestern High School with a .467 batting average, 31 RBIs and a college commitment to Southwestern Illinois College, helping lead the Piasa Birds to 18 wins and a deep regional run in late May 2026.
Hagen, a multi-sport athlete and infielder for Southwestern, was a key contributor in the cleanup spot during her final high school season. She also hit one home run.

Among her notable performances, Hagen had four hits in a 16-2 victory against Marquette Catholic, a game highlighted by RiverBender. She also delivered a go-ahead single in the seventh inning to beat Calhoun.
Her coach, Amanda Edwards, credited Hagen not only for her production at the plate but also for her leadership.
“Josie speaks softly and carried a big stick,” Edwards said. “She inspired the other kids with her play and actions.”
Beyond softball, Hagen earned recognition as an all-around athlete at Southwestern, where she also excelled in basketball and volleyball.
Hagen has signed to continue her academic and athletic career at Southwestern Illinois College.
